Creating an Attention-Grabbing Profile

Your LinkedIn profile is your digital calling card. It’s essential to make it stand out and showcase your unique value proposition. Start by customizing your headline. Instead of just listing your job title, create a compelling and keyword-rich headline that highlights your skills and expertise. Next, craft a captivating summary that tells your story, outlines your accomplishments, and showcases your personality. Don’t forget to upload a high-quality, professional headshot to increase your profile’s visibility. Detail your work history and highlight your key achievements in each role. Enrich your profile by adding relevant images, videos, or presentations. Request endorsements for your skills and recommendations from colleagues, clients, or supervisors. Finally, make your profile URL unique and easy to share by customizing it with your name.

Expanding Your Network

Building a strong network is crucial for career growth. To expand your LinkedIn connections, start by connecting with people you already know from your professional and personal life. Participate in industry-specific groups to meet like-minded professionals and engage in discussions. Attend various webinars and virtual events offered by LinkedIn, where you can connect with other professionals. When connecting with new people, add a personalized note to increase the chances of acceptance.

Engaging with Your Connections

To truly benefit from LinkedIn, it’s essential to actively engage with your connections. Start by sharing valuable content, such as industry news, insightful articles, or thought leadership pieces. This will help establish your expertise and generate engagement from your network. Make sure to like, comment on, and share your connections’ updates, as this shows your interest in their activities and fosters stronger relationships. Don’t be afraid to reach out to your connections for advice, introductions, or to discuss potential collaboration opportunities. Finally, remember to regularly update your profile with your latest accomplishments and career milestones to keep your network informed of your progress.

Utilizing LinkedIn’s Job Search Features

LinkedIn offers a powerful job search engine, with a wide variety of filters and features to help you find the perfect opportunity. Start by setting up job alerts based on your desired job title, location, and industry. This will ensure that you’re notified of relevant job openings as they’re posted. Use the “Easy Apply” feature to streamline the application process for many jobs, allowing you to apply with just a few clicks. Be sure to leverage the “Jobs” tab on company pages to discover openings at specific organizations you’re interested in. Additionally, consider reaching out to your connections at companies you’re applying to, as they may be able to provide valuable insights or referrals.
